Optimizing Passive Solar Design

One of the most effective methods architects use is passive solar design. By strategically placing windows, awnings, and roof overhangs, they can naturally control how much sunlight enters the home throughout the year.

During the winter, large south-facing windows capture the sun’s warmth, naturally heating the interior spaces. Conversely, deep overhangs block the harsh summer sun, keeping the home naturally cool and reducing the heavy reliance on air conditioning units.

Utilizing High-Performance Insulation

A well-insulated exterior is the absolute backbone of any energy-efficient home. Architects specify advanced insulation materials for walls, roofs, and foundations to create a continuous thermal barrier against the outside elements.

Options like spray foam insulation or rigid foam boards help eliminate drafts and prevent thermal bridging. This meticulous attention to the building’s thermal envelope is a prime example of How Architects Create Energy-Efficient and Sustainable Home Exteriors.

Choosing Eco-Friendly Building Materials

The selection of exterior cladding and roofing materials plays a massive role in a home’s overall sustainability. Architects increasingly favor building materials that are recycled, locally sourced, or highly durable.

Examples include reclaimed wood, fiber cement siding, and standing seam metal roofing. These materials not only have a lower environmental impact during production but also require less maintenance and replacement over the home’s lifespan.

Smart Water Management Systems

Sustainability also encompasses how a home interacts with local water resources and natural rainfall. Exterior designs now frequently feature intelligent water management solutions to reduce environmental impact.

Rainwater Harvesting Techniques

Architects often design specific roof slopes and hidden gutter systems to channel rainwater into underground collection tanks. This harvested water can then be used for landscape irrigation or even non-potable indoor uses.

By reducing reliance on municipal water supplies, homes become much more self-sufficient. This practice significantly lowers the ecological footprint of the property over time.

Permeable Paving and Landscaping

Traditional concrete driveways and walkways contribute to harmful stormwater runoff. To combat this, architects specify permeable paving materials that allow rainwater to naturally seep back into the earth.

Combined with drought-resistant native landscaping, these exterior choices protect local waterways and promote healthy soil. It is a vital, yet often overlooked, aspect of comprehensive sustainable exterior design.
